Arch Linux Installation Time Optimization

Arch Linux’s installation time can be influenced by several factors, including the user’s hardware, the selected desktop environment, and the network speed. The hardware’s processing power and memory capacity impact the speed of the installation process. The desktop environment selected can also affect the installation time, as some environments require more packages and configurations than others. Finally, the network speed plays a role in determining how quickly the necessary packages can be downloaded during the installation.

The Disk Drive Dilemma: SSD vs. HDD in Installation Performance

When it comes to installing software, your storage is the unsung hero. Just like a race car needs a smooth track, your installation process depends on the performance of your disk drive. But here’s the million-dollar question: SSD or HDD, which one reigns supreme?

Let’s start with HDDs (Hard Disk Drives). Picture an old-fashioned record player, only instead of a needle, it’s a mechanical arm that reads and writes data to spinning disks. HDDs are like the workhorses of storage, reliable and affordable, but not the speed demons we crave.

SSDs (Solid State Drives), on the other hand, are the sleek sports cars of the storage world. They use flash memory chips, so no moving parts here. This means lightning-fast read and write speeds, making SSDs perfect for rapid-fire installations.

So, which one should you choose? If you’re an impatient soul who wants that software up and running in a flash, SSD is your golden ticket. But if you’re on a budget or don’t mind a slightly slower installation, HDDs are still a solid (pun intended) option.

Parallel Installation: The Pros and Cons of Installing Multiple Apps Simultaneously

Ever felt like your installation process was taking forever? You’re not alone! Many factors can influence how long it takes to install a program, including your network speed, system configuration, and even the programs currently running in the background.

But what if there was a way to speed things up a bit? Enter parallel installation. It’s like having multiple construction crews working on your house at the same time. Instead of installing one program at a time, parallel installation allows you to install multiple programs simultaneously.

This can save you a lot of time, especially if you’re installing several large programs. However, there are also some potential drawbacks to consider:

  • Increased system load: Installing multiple programs at the same time can put a strain on your system’s resources. This can lead to slower performance and potential crashes.
  • Potential conflicts: If two programs try to install the same files or use the same system resources, it can lead to conflicts. This can cause installation failures or even system instability.
  • Reduced reliability: Installing multiple programs at the same time can increase the chances of something going wrong. If one installation fails, it can affect the other installations in progress.

So, should you use parallel installation? It depends. If you’re installing several large programs and you have a fast, stable system, it can be a great way to save time. However, if you’re concerned about system performance or potential conflicts, it’s best to stick to installing one program at a time.
